Transaction bb08dbcafa0ea940eb54022736d9766eecfc1afa10b97812f6ab670ef68a7609
1 Input
1 Output
-
bb08dbcafa0ea940eb54022736d9766eecfc1afa10b97812f6ab670ef68a7609:0
- value
- 37310632
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5054e2477e876ca0194121f595dbf47eb5bb59c
- address
- bc1qu5z5ufrhapmv5qv5zg04jhdlgl44hdvusad476